centos統一管理jdk工具jenv使用

2022-09-08 05:54:13 字數 873 閱讀 1842

centos統一管理jdk工具jenv使用

1.安裝git,並檢視版本

yum -y install git

git --version

$ git clone ~/.jenv

3.配入環境變數

echo 'export path="$home/.jenv/bin:$path"' >> ~/.bash_profile

4.執行 jenv init -命令,這樣每開啟乙個 bash 終端就可以呼叫 jenv 命令,並且預設執行一次 jenv init - 命令。

$ echo 'eval "$(jenv init -)"' >> ~/.bash_profile

$ source ~/.bash_profile

5.找到jdk1.8和jdk11的資料夾路徑,加入到jenv的管理庫

$ jenv add /opt/j**a/jdk1.8.0_144

$ jenv add /opt/j**a/jdk1.11.0.5

6.檢視已經新增的j**a版本

7.配置要使用的jvm。有三種方式:global:按全域性、lacal:按目錄、shell:shell

jenv global 1.7.0_80

$ jenv local jdk1.7.0_80

$ jenv shell jdk1.7.0_80

8.檢視當前j**a版:j**a -version

Gradle統一管理版本

為了提高專案開發效率,在實際專案開發過程中往往會引入一些開源框架,還有專案中使用的各種module,當引入module過多時最好提供一種統一的方式去管理版本號,如 compilesdkversion buildtoolsversion androidtestcompile 等,便於日後對版本號進行維...

php統一管理crontab

統一管理crontab計畫任務的關鍵點,在於實現像crontab一樣對 10 這樣的命令如何進行解析。解析完成最後呼叫系統函式執行shell命令 新建控制器 console controllers testcroncontroller新增任務 this cronjobs hello index he...

Redis Key 統一管理技巧

我們的專案中可能存在多種業務場景需要接入 redis 快取,在插入快取時需要設定 key,如果這個 key 散落在專案的各個業務 中的話,會給後期維護帶來很大的不便。所以我建議把系統中用到快取 key 放到乙個類中統一管理,相同業務的 key 放到一起,這樣也提高了系統 的可讀性,讓看這個系統的人一...